Program Description Candidate undergoes coursework for 12 credit and carries out research to prepared thesis under particular area of specialization. The time taken for PhD programme is generally 3 to 5 years for full-time candidates and 4 to 6 years for part-time candidates.
Admission & entry requirements A candidate who has obtained any Master’s Degree of Mangalore University or any other University considered as equivalent thereto with a minimum of 55% marks (50% for SC/ST/Cat-I candidates and Physically challenged candidates) in aggregate or equivalent grade. The teachers employed in University/ Affiliated Colleges before 31-03-1992 and are continuing in service on a regular basis shall be permitted if they have a minimum of 50% of marks at the Master’s Degree course. The candidate shall work for Ph.D. degree in a subject studied at the Master’s Degree or related subject under a recognized guide. However, he/she may be permitted with the approval of the concerned Board of Studies, to conduct research in a subject other than the one chosen for the Master’s Degree, provided it is of an interdisciplinary nature. If the research topic is of interdisciplinary nature, the candidate with the consent of his guide may opt for a co-guide, who shall also be the recognized guide of the University. However, the main responsibility of supervising the research work shall vest with the guide and the candidate shall finalize and submit the thesis through the guide.
